Pros And Cons Of Pinhole Eyeglasses

There are many products in the market to give your eyes a clear vision. Prescription glasses are made for eyes to help them see clear and neat images without having to do surgical corrections. However, there are glasses known as "pinhole glasses" that are invented to improve long sight or short sight problems. These can also be found in the market as stenopeic glasses.
These eye glasses are made up of an opaque substance like metal or plastic and proved to give 100% safety to your eyes. The pinhole eyeglasses are designed with pin-sized holes covered with a plastic material to give your eye the clear view reducing the confusion caused to retina due to different rays with multi focusing energy.
Pinhole glasses work similar to cameras with pinhole technology. If the eye sight is affected then the light rays entering the eye cannot focus on the same place in retina leading to unclear ...
... and blurred image. Pinhole glasses are designed specifically so that the rays entering the eye will have the same focus concentrating on retina thus providing with the clear and neat image. The pinhole glasses allow rays with same focus to enter the eye thus helping retina to form the clear image. This provides the additional benefit of eye relaxation as it avoids the extra work of eye muscles of collecting the rays with same focus entering the eye.
The advantages of these pinhole glasses over conventional ones obviously make them more popular. Additionally, these are lightweight, durable, attractive and affordable as well but since every thing will have both positive and negative sides there are some dark sides too. Pinhole glasses have two major disadvantages. The blocking of some light rays diminishes the light intensity and the peripheral vision is diminished, too. Due to this reason, they should not be used while operating machines, driving and in any activity that involves motion. This feature made them weak in not being able to completely replace the traditional and conventional glasses since the conventional ones can be used in all situations and conditions unlike pinhole glasses. As in the modern times, the pinholes have same plastic used in prescription lenses thus providing ultraviolet protection to the eyes.
